The Translation and Interpretation program at Eastern Mediterranean University in Northern Cyprus offers a comprehensive curriculum designed to equip students with advanced linguistic skills and cultural competence. This program emphasizes practical training in both written translation and oral interpretation across multiple languages. Students will engage in diverse modules including simultaneous and consecutive interpretation, translation theory, and language technologies. The course integrates modern tools and real-world case studies, preparing graduates for dynamic roles in global communication. With a focus on humanities, the program nurtures critical thinking, cross-cultural understanding, and professional ethics. Graduates will be proficient in facilitating communication in legal, medical, commercial, and diplomatic contexts. The university's multicultural environment further enhances students’ exposure to international practices and standards, making them competitive candidates in the global job market. Eastern Mediterranean University supports students with experienced faculty, state-of-the-art facilities, and opportunities for internships and collaborations with industry stakeholders, ensuring a well-rounded educational experience in the field of translation and interpretation.

Graduates of the Translation and Interpretation program can pursue careers as professional translators, interpreters, linguistic consultants, and localization specialists. Opportunities exist within international organizations, government agencies, multinational corporations, media outlets, and non-governmental organizations. The program prepares students for roles in legal, medical, technical, and conference interpreting. Alumni often work as freelance language service providers or join translation agencies. The acquired skills also open pathways in language technology development, teaching, and research. With increasing globalization, demand for qualified language professionals remains strong, offering diverse and rewarding career prospects.
Applicants must have a high school diploma or an equivalent qualification recognized by the university. A minimum GPA of 2.5 on a 4.0 scale is generally required. Proficiency in at least two languages is advantageous. Submission of transcripts, a completed application form, and proof of English language proficiency are mandatory. Additionally, candidates may be required to submit a statement of purpose and letters of recommendation. Some programs may conduct an interview or entrance exam to assess applicants' aptitude for translation and interpretation. International students must provide certified copies of academic credentials and passport identification. Meeting the university’s English language requirements is essential for admission. Early application is encouraged due to limited seats and competitive selection criteria. Admission decisions are based on academic merit, language skills, and overall suitability for the program.

Applicants must demonstrate proficiency in English, typically through standardized tests such as IELTS with a minimum overall score of 6.0 or TOEFL with a minimum score of 80. Alternative qualifications assessed on a case-by-case basis include equivalent language diplomas or prior education in English-medium institutions. Meeting these requirements ensures students can effectively engage with course materials, participate in discussions, and complete assignments. The university may offer preparatory English language courses for students needing additional support before starting the program.

The tuition fees for the Translation and Interpretation program vary for international and local students. International students pay approximately 6500 USD per academic year, while local students benefit from a reduced fee of around 3000 USD per year. Fees cover academic instruction, access to university facilities, and student support services. Additional costs may include textbooks, materials, and technology fees. Payment plans and scholarship options are available to assist students in managing tuition expenses.

International students enrolling at Eastern Mediterranean University need to obtain a student visa to study in Northern Cyprus. The visa application process requires an acceptance letter from the university, a valid passport, proof of financial means, and health insurance coverage. Applicants should submit their visa application to the nearest Northern Cyprus consulate or embassy prior to arrival. Processing times may vary, so early application is recommended. Students must comply with visa conditions, including maintaining enrollment status and adhering to the duration of stay allowed. The university provides guidance and support throughout the visa application process to ensure a smooth transition for international students.
